Over the weekend Epic Games‘ popular battle royale-styled game Fortnite blew up and replaced itself with a black hole leaving many fans distraught.

Fortnite has yet to return since Sunday’s season-ending event. However an apparent trailer for the next “Battle Pass” (titled “Chapter 2 – Season 1”) has been uploaded to YouTube, giving fans a first few details on the forthcoming chapter. The video also teases a first look at the new map and new additions on the way.

Kicking off the trailer is a number of new locales, including a river, a power plant, a beach, and a fishing pond, and it looks like players will actually be able to fish in that fishing pond, as well as drive a boat, swim, and hop around on a pogo stick. Moving on, the trailer states there will be new ways to level up, while players in the visuals are seen being rewarded with medals for a headshot, opening a treasure chest, and even just chopping down a tree. Additionally the trailer showcases an array of new skins.

So far it is unknown when Fortnite will return, however rumors are suggesting the game will return on Tuesday, October 15. Fortnite is currently available on PlayStation 4, Xbox One, Nintendo Switch, PC, Mac, and most mobile devices.
